SoLittle thanks. but i do not loose power the rpms race to the topend 4500 to 5000 rpms with no thrust (tork). tonight we explored further with the motor placing a wedge in the flywheel so it could not turn, the prop will now turn on the shaft(plastic bushing?) very snuggly, but it will turn. do props wear out???

sounds like you spun the prop. Pull it and replace the hub assembly.Make sure your shaft is not worn down.
